High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les! As of 2005, Germany had a railway network of 41,315 km. 19,857 km are electrified. The total track length was 76,473 km. The UIC Country Code for the German railway system is 80. In 2006, railways in Germany carried ca. 119,968,000 passengers in long-distance trains (at an average distance of 288 km), and 2,091,828,000 passengers in short-distance trains (21 km on average). In the same year they carried 346,118,000 tonnes of goods at an average distance of 309 km. Deutsche Bahn (state-owned private company) is the main provider of railway service. In recent years a number of competitors have started business. They mostly offer state-subsidized regional services, but some, like Veolia Verkehr offer long-distance services as well.
